About West Bromwich

West Bromwich is a town of about 78,000 people (2018) in the Metropolitan Borough ofSandwell, in theWest Midlands. It is 5 miles (8 km) northwest ofBirminghamlying on the A41 London-to-Birkenhead road and is part of the Black Country. Historically within Staffordshire, West Bromwich is the largest town within Sandwell.
